Если в ячейках Microsoft Excel буквы отображаются разного размера — проблема не в программе, а в настройках форматирования. Чаще всего это происходит после копирования данных из других источников (веб-страниц, Word, PDF) или при ручном изменении шрифта в отдельных ячейках. В 90% случаев достаточно применить единый стиль шрифта ко всему диапазону, но есть и менее очевидные причины — например, объединённые ячейки с разным форматированием или скрытые символы переноса, которые ломают отображение текста.
В этой статье разберём все способы выравнивания размера букв — от базовых (через ленту инструментов) до продвинутых (с использованием VBA для массовой обработки). Особое внимание уделим типичным ошибкам: почему после изменения шрифта размер букв всё равно отличается, и как это исправить без потери данных. Все инструкции актуальны для Excel 2010–2021 и Microsoft 365, включая веб-версию.
1. Быстрое выравнивание через ленту инструментов
Самый простой способ сделать буквы одинаковыми — использовать панель «Шрифт» на вкладке Главная. Этот метод подходит, если разница в размерах видна невооружённым глазом и вызвана ручным форматированием.
Как это работает:
- 📌 Выделите диапазон ячеек с неравномерным шрифтом (например,
A1:D20). - 🔍 На вкладке
Главнаяв группе «Шрифт» проверьте текущий размер (например,11 пт). - 🖱️ Кликните по полю с размером шрифта и выберите нужное значение (рекомендуется
10–12 птдля читаемости). - ✅ Нажмите
Enter— размер букв во всех выделенных ячейках станет одинаковым.
Важно: Если после этого некоторые буквы всё равно выглядят крупнее, проверьте наличие жирного начертания (Ctrl+B) или подчёркивания — они визуально искажают восприятие размера. Сбросьте форматирование через кнопку Очистить → Очистить форматы (группа «Редактирование»).
2. Использование стилей ячеек для единообразия
Стили ячеек в Excel позволяют быстро применить заранее настроенное форматирование, включая размер шрифта. Это удобно, если вы работаете с большими таблицами и хотите избежать ручной настройки.
Пошаговая инструкция:
- Выделите диапазон ячеек.
- Перейдите на вкладку
Главная→ группа «Стили». - Щёлкните по стрелке в правом нижнем углу группы, чтобы открыть окно «Стили ячеек».
- Выберите стиль
Обычный(сбрасывает все настройки) или создайте свой стиль:→ Новый стиль ячеек → Укажите имя (например, "Стандартный текст") → На вкладке "Шрифт" выберите размер (например, 11 пт) → ОК - Примените стиль к выделенным ячейкам.
Преимущество стилей: они сохраняются в файле и могут быть повторно использованы. Например, если вы создадите стиль Заголовок с размером шрифта 14 пт, его можно будет применить к любым ячейкам в будущем.
3. Проблема с объединёнными ячейками: как исправить
Объединённые ячейки (Ctrl+1 → Выравнивание → Объединить ячейки) часто становятся причиной неравномерного размера букв. Дело в том, что при объединении Excel может сохранять разное форматирование для разных частей текста, даже если визуально это не заметно.
Как проверить и исправить:
- 🔎 Выделите объединённую ячейку и посмотрите на панель «Шрифт». Если кнопка размера шрифта пустая — значит, в ячейке смешаны разные форматы.
- 🛠️ Разъедините ячейки:
Главная → Выравнивание → Отменить объединение. - 📏 Выделите текст и установите одинаковый размер шрифта.
- 🔗 Объедините ячейки заново, если это необходимо.
Почему объединённые ячейки ломают форматирование?
При объединении Excel сохраняет историю форматирования каждой исходной ячейки. Если до объединения в них были разные шрифты, программа может "запоминать" это и применять смешанное форматирование.
⚠️ Внимание: Если после разъединения ячеек текст "расползётся" по нескольким ячейкам, используйтеПеренос текста(Ctrl+1 → Выравнивание → Переносить по словам) или увеличьте ширину столбца.
4. Скрытые символы и переносы: как они влияют на размер букв
Невидимые символы — например, мягкие переносы (Alt+0173) или разрывы строк (Alt+Enter) — могут заставлять Excel отображать текст неравномерно. Это особенно заметно при копировании данных из Word или веб-страниц.
Как обнаружить и устранить:
- Включите отображение скрытых символов:
Файл → Параметры → Дополнительно → Показывать параметры для следующего листа → Отметить "Показывать все знаки форматирования". - Если в ячейке видны точки (·) или стрелки (↓), удалите их вручную или используйте функцию
=ПЕЧСИМВ(), чтобы очистить текст. - Примените одинаковый размер шрифта заново.
Для массовой очистки скрытых символов используйте найти и заменить:
- 🔍 Нажмите
Ctrl+H. - 📝 В поле «Найти» вставьте символ переноса (скопируйте его из ячейки или введите
Alt+0173). - 🗑️ Оставьте поле «Зменить на» пустым и нажмите
Заменить всё.
| Символ | Код ввода | Влияние на размер букв |
|---|---|---|
| Мягкий перенос | Alt+0173 |
Может разрывать слова, создавая визуальную неравномерность |
| Жёсткий перенос | Alt+Enter |
Приводит к разному межстрочному интервалу |
| Неразрывный пробел | Alt+0160 |
Искажает выравнивание текста по ширине |
5. Горячие клавиши для быстрого форматирования
Если вам часто приходится выравнивать размер букв, запомните эти комбинации:
- 🔠
Ctrl+Shift+F— открыть окно «Формат ячеек» на вкладкеШрифт. - 📏
Alt+H, H— выбрать размер шрифта (последовательно нажимайте клавиши). - 🎨
Ctrl+1— быстрое форматирование ячейки (аналог правой кнопки → «Формат ячеек»). - 🧹
Ctrl+Space(выделить столбец) +Shift+Space(выделить строку) → затем установите размер шрифта.
Для сброса всего форматирования в выделенных ячейках используйте:
Главная → Редактирование → Очистить → Очистить форматы
Выделите проблемный диапазон|Проверьте панель "Шрифт" на наличие пустого поля размера|Сбросьте форматирование через "Очистить форматы"|Примените одинаковый размер шрифта|Проверьте объединённые ячейки и скрытые символы-->
6. Автоматизация через VBA (для продвинутых пользователей)
Если вам нужно регулярно выравнивать размер шрифта в больших файлах, напишите простой макрос. Он применит одинаковый размер ко всем ячейкам на активном листе.
Инструкция:
- Нажмите
Alt+F11, чтобы открыть редактор VBA. - Вставьте новый модуль:
Вставка → Модуль. - Скопируйте этот код:
Sub UniformFontSize()Dim ws As Worksheet
Dim rng As Range
Set ws = ActiveSheet
Set rng = ws.UsedRange
rng.Font.Size = 11 ' Укажите нужный размер
rng.Font.Bold = False ' Снять жирное начертание
rng.Font.Italic = False ' Снять курсив
End Sub
- Закройте редактор и запустите макрос:
Alt+F8 → Выберите UniformFontSize → Выполнить.
Чтобы макрос работал для всех листов книги, замените ActiveSheet на:
Dim ws As Worksheet
For Each ws In ThisWorkbook.Worksheets
ws.UsedRange.Font.Size = 11
Next ws
⚠️ Внимание: Перед запуском макроса сохраните файл в формате.xlsm(с поддержкой макросов) и проверьте его на копии данных. Макрос перезапишет все настройки шрифта без возможности отмены (Ctrl+Zне работает для VBA).
7. Проверка настройки масштаба отображения
Иногда проблема не в шрифте, а в масштабе отображения листа. Если в Excel установлен масштаб отображения менее 100%, буквы могут казаться неравномерными, хотя их реальный размер одинаков.
Как проверить:
- 🔍 В правом нижнем углу окна Excel найдите ползунок масштаба (рядом с кнопкой
+/–). - 📊 Установите значение
100%. - 🔄 Если буквы стали выглядеть одинаково — проблема была в масштабе, а не в шрифте.
Также проверьте настройки «Параметры страницы» (вкладка Разметка страницы), если готовите таблицу к печати. Опция Подогнать под может искажать отображение шрифтов при предварительном просмотре.
FAQ: Частые вопросы о размере букв в Excel
❓ Почему после копирования из Word в Excel буквы разного размера?
Word сохраняет индивидуальное форматирование каждого символа, а Excel переносит его "как есть". Чтобы исправить:
- Вставьте данные через
Специальная вставка → Текст(Ctrl+Alt+V → T). - Примените одинаковый шрифт ко всему диапазону.
❓ Можно ли сделать так, чтобы Excel автоматически выравнивал размер шрифта?
Нет, в Excel нет встроенной функции автовыравнивания шрифта. Но вы можете:
- Использовать стили ячеек (см. раздел 2).
- Настроить шаблон книги (
.xltx) с заранее заданным шрифтом. - Применить VBA-макрос (раздел 6) при открытии файла.
❓ Влияет ли размер шрифта на ширину столбца?
Да, Excel автоматически подстраивает ширину столбца под содержимое. Если после изменения шрифта текст "не влазит", сделайте следующее:
- Выделите столбец (например, кликните по букве
A). - Дважды щёлкните по правой границе заголовка столбца — ширина подстроится под текст.
- Или задайте фиксированную ширину:
Главная → Формат → Ширина столбца.
❓ Почему в печатной версии размер букв отличается от экрана?
Это связано с настройками принтера и параметрами страницы. Проверьте:
- Масштаб печати:
Файл → Печать → Настройки → Масштаб(должен быть100%). - Поля страницы: узкие поля могут сжимать текст.
- Опцию
Подогнать подна вкладкеРазметка страницы— она искажает шрифты.
Для точного отображения используйте Файл → Печать → Предварительный просмотр.
❓ Как изменить размер шрифта по умолчанию для новых книг?
Чтобы все новые файлы открывались с нужным размером шрифта:
- Создайте пустую книгу и установите желаемый шрифт (например,
Calibri 11 пт). - Удалите все листы, кроме одного.
- Сохраните файл как шаблон:
Файл → Сохранить как → Шаблон Excel (*.xltx). - Поместите шаблон в папку
C:\Users\[Ваше_имя]\Documents\Custom Office Templates.
Теперь при создании новой книги (Файл → Создать → Личные) будет использоваться ваш шаблон.